Celebrating the Life of Melanie Nicole Ortega
It is with profound sadness that we announce the passing of Melanie Nicole Ortega, of Conroe, TX, beloved wife, daughter, and friend. Born as Melanie on May 23, 1970, on Forbes Air Force base near Topeka, KS and departed this world on November 19, 2025, in Houston, TX, leaving behind a legacy of love, kindness, and inspiration to all who knew her.
A Life Well Lived
Melanie's life was a testament to compassion, generosity, and strength. She lived a post-transplant life of service to and with her transplant community. Melanie was a dual lung and kidney transplant recipient – in September 2017. She was an active member of the Houston Methodist Support Group for Lung and Heart Transplant. She volunteered her time at the hospital, and she shared her experiences and offered council to those new to the transplant world, or those who just needed a calm voice full of encouragement and a welcoming feeling of community. Her unwavering dedication to her family was matched only by her commitment to helping others. Melanie approached every challenge with grace and perseverance, serving as a source of encouragement and wisdom to those around her.
Family and Community
Melanie was preceded in death by her father, David Guy King. Melanie is survived by her husband, Gregory Joseph Ortega; her mother, Audrey Janelle King, nee Browning; and her brother, Joshua Maxwell King. She will be fondly remembered by her numerous friends whose lives she touched. Her devotion to her loved ones and her involvement in her transplant community will remain an enduring legacy.
Legacy and Remembrance
Melanie was an avid reader. She loved many genres of written text, from nonfiction to fantasy. In her working life she was a Production Editor at Oxford University Press. Melanie loved her many pets throughout her life. She partnered with Count Chocula, "Choc" her Cairn Terrier, to achieve the highest level of success earning the Endurance Earthdog Title.
